Renault Alliance



         


The Renault 9 and Renault 11 are compact automobiles, launched in the early 1980s, by the French car manufacturer Renault.

The 9 was a 4-door sedan, launched in 1982, and was winner of the Car Of The Year award of the same year. A version of the 9 was produced by American Motors in the United States, where it was known as the Alliance.

The 11 is a 3 or 5-door hatchback, and was launched in late 1983. The US version was known as the Encore.

Although the two cars have different names, and silhouettes, they are in fact identical under the skin, and were intended to jointly replace the older Renault 14.

Both cars were somewhat unremarkable, using Renault's archaic C-type overhead valve engines in 1.1 or 1.4 litre format, and a basic suspension design which resulted in a rather ordinary driving experience. The newer F-type engine which had been developed in collaboration with Volvo appeared in later years in 1.7 litre guise.

The 11 did have one moment of movie stardom in the 1985 James Bond film A View to a Kill, where Bond steals a Renault 11 taxi from a Parisian cab driver and uses it to pursue an assassin. The car has its roof torn off in the resulting car chase, and is then chopped in half in a collision with another car (a Renault 20!).

Aside from these dizzy heights, the 9 and 11 were replaced in 1988 by the Renault 19.
